Starting October 12, (well yesterday for me) Delta and Starbucks began offering users the ability to link their SkyMiles and Starbucks Rewards accounts to earn simultaneous rewards. Quick recap of the details:

  • 1 mile earned for every $1 spent at Starbucks
  • 500 miles upon initiation
  • 150 starts upon initiation
  • Double stars on Delta travel days

Maybe this is just about two companies working together to increase consumer loyalty. However, my concern, as a skeptical consumer, is about how this will affect me. With linkages between programs, should I be aware of privacy issues that could result? Would Delta know more about where all I buy my coffee? Would Starbucks learn more about my itinerary? Is Big Brother going to be tracking me even more highly as a result?

As of now, they have not provided updated privacy policies to explain how information linked in this program will be protected. In each company’s announcement and on the sign-up pages, they only link to their existing privacy policies.
